STEP 15: Cut out the template that is found on Page 6. Place this template across the rear portion of the black inner console. Mark the correct scribe lines.

STEP 18: With the rear portion of the black con- sole, now modified. Place the supplied pair of wash- ers, tucked in the corners. Mark washer’s inner holes and then remove the washers.
➔ ➔ ➔
STEP 19: With a drill and 1/2” drill bit, drill holes at marked location of the washers.
STEP 20: Using the supplied hardware of (2) 3/8”- 16 x 1” hex bolts, (2) 3/8” flat washers and (2) lock washers. Attach this drilled out position of the black console, to the rear of the enclosure.
